
@media (min-width: 992px) and (max-width: 1199px) {
	.server-list {
		width: auto;
		left: 30px;
		right: 30px;
		-webkit-transform: translateX(0);
		-moz-transform: translateX(0);
		-ms-transform: translateX(0);
		-o-transform: translateX(0);
		transform: translateX(0);
	}
}

@media (max-width: 1199px) {

	html, body {
		overflow-x: hidden;
	}

	/* Header */
	.header {
		padding-top: 30px;
	}
	.main-menu,
	.mini-profile {
		display: none;
	}
	.mobile-nav__toggle {
		display: block;
	}
	.header-line {
	    margin: 30px 0;
	}

	/* Hero */
	.hero__collage {
	    right: -288px;
	}

	/* How to start */
	.how-to-start {
		padding-top: 216px;
	}
	.how-to-start__header {
		margin-bottom: 60px;
	}
	.how-to-start__header .section-header__title {
		margin-bottom: 24px;
	}
	.how-to-start .section-header__desc {
		margin-bottom: 44px;
	}
	.instruction {
		padding: 60px 0;
	}
	.instruction-item {
		padding-top: 30px;
		padding-bottom: 30px;
	}

	/* News */
	.news {
		padding: 60px 0;
	}
	.news-carousel .slick-track {
		padding-top: 60px;
	}

	/* Social */
	.social {
		padding: 60px 0;
	}
	.social-item {
		padding-bottom: 30px;
	}
	.social-item__logo {
		width: 60px !important;
	}
	.social-item__members img {
		width: 180px !important;
	}

}

@media (max-width: 991px) {

	.container {
		max-width: 100%;
		padding-left: 30px;
		padding-right: 30px;
	}

	/* Hero */
	.server-list {
		display: block;
		padding: 0 15px 40px;
		overflow-x: scroll;
		white-space: nowrap;
		background: none;
		bottom: -192px;
		-webkit-box-shadow: none;
		-moz-box-shadow: none;
		box-shadow: none;
		-webkit-border-radius: 0;
		-moz-border-radius: 0;
		border-radius: 0;
	}
	.server-item {
		display: inline-block;
		margin: 0 15px;
		padding: 30px;
		min-width: 198px;
		width: auto;
		background-color: #fff;
		-webkit-border-radius: 10px;
		-moz-border-radius: 10px;
		border-radius: 10px;
		-webkit-box-shadow: 0px 6px 32px rgba(47, 8, 95, 0.3);
		-moz-box-shadow: 0px 6px 32px rgba(47, 8, 95, 0.3);
		box-shadow: 0px 6px 32px rgba(47, 8, 95, 0.3);
	}

	/* How to start */
	.how-to-start__quote {
		padding: 15px;
		font-size: 16px;
		line-height: 26px;
	}
	.instruction {
		padding-bottom: 30px;
	}
	.instruction-item {
		margin-bottom: 30px;
		padding-left: 15px;
		padding-right: 15px;
		height: auto;
	}
	.instruction-item__text {
		height: auto !important;
	}
	.instruction-item__btn {
		display: inline-block;
		max-width: 308px;
		width: 100%;
	}

	/* News */
	.news-item__body {
		padding: 30px 15px;
	}

	/* Social */
	.social {
		padding-bottom: 30px;
	}
	.social-item {
		margin-bottom: 30px;
		padding-left: 15px;
		padding-right: 15px;
	}

	/* Footer */
	.footer {
		padding-top: 60px;
		padding-bottom: 30px;
	}
	.footer .col-12 {
		margin-bottom: 30px;
	}
	.footer__logo {
		margin-bottom: 30px;
	}
	.copyright__small {
		margin-bottom: 30px;
	}

	/* Content */
	.content {
		margin-bottom: 60px;
	}
	.page-transfers {
		padding-bottom: 60px;
	}
	.profile-stats {
		margin-bottom: 30px;
	}
	.profile-stats__item-first {
		margin-bottom: 15px;
	}
	.profile-stats__item-first p {
		display: inline-block;
		white-space: nowrap;
	}
	.profile-cards {
		margin-bottom: 15px;
	}
	.profile-card {
		margin-bottom: 15px;
	}
	.page-about__section {
	}
	.page-about__section_type_highlighted {
	    padding-top: 44px;
	    padding-bottom: 44px;
	}
	.page-about__section_text_left,
	.page-about__section_text_right {
	    margin-left: 0;
	    margin-right: 0;
	    padding-right: 30px;
	    padding-left: 30px;
	}
	.page-about__section-1 {
		margin-top: 24px;
		padding: 0 !important;
		color: #333;
		background: none !important;
	}
	.page-about__section-1 h2 {
		margin-bottom: 52px;
		color: #333;
	}
	.page-about__section-video,
	.page-about__section-4,
	.page-about__section-6 {
		margin-left: -30px;
		margin-right: -30px;
	}
	.page-about__section-video > iframe {
		height: 386px !important;
	}
	.page-about__section-3 > .row > .col-12:first-child {
		margin-bottom: 44px;
	}
	.page-about__section-3 > .row > .col-12:last-child {
		text-align: center;
	}
	.page-about__section-5 > .row {
		-webkit-box-orient: vertical;
		-webkit-box-direction: reverse;
		-webkit-flex-direction: column-reverse;
		-moz-box-orient: vertical;
		-moz-box-direction: reverse;
		-ms-flex-direction: column-reverse;
		flex-direction: column-reverse;
	}
	.page-about__section-5 > .row > .col-12:first-child {
		text-align: center;
	}
	.page-about__section-5 > .row > .col-12:last-child {
		margin-bottom: 44px;
	}
	.page-about__section-image {
		display: none;
	}
	.page-roulette__balance,
	.page-roulette__nav,
	.roulette-carousel__start-holder,
	.page-roulette__h2 {
		margin-bottom: 68px;
	}
	.roulette-carousel {
		margin-bottom: 34px;
	}
	.roulette-prize-list__categories {
		margin-bottom: -60px;
	}
	.about-roulette__image {
		display: none;
	}
	.about-roulette .row .col-12 {
		padding-bottom: 60px;
	}

}

@media (max-width: 959px) {

	/* News */
	.news-carousel .news-item__wrapper {
		padding: 0 20px;
	}
	.news-carousel .slick-slide .news-item {
		-webkit-box-shadow: 0px 6px 32px rgba(47,8,95,0.3);
		-moz-box-shadow: 0px 6px 32px rgba(47,8,95,0.3);
		box-shadow: 0px 6px 32px rgba(47,8,95,0.3);
	}

}

@media (max-width: 767px) {

	/* Hero */
	.hero,
	.hero .container {
		height: auto;
	}
	.hero__content {
		padding-bottom: 174px;
		position: relative;
		z-index: 5;
	}
	.hero__collage {
		max-width: none;
		right: -320px;
	}

	/* Content */
	.profile-stats {
		margin-top: 30px;
	}
	.donate-wrapper {
		margin-bottom: 90px;
		-webkit-box-orient: horizontal;
		-webkit-box-direction: normal;
		-webkit-flex-direction: row;
		-moz-box-orient: horizontal;
		-moz-box-direction: normal;
		-ms-flex-direction: row;
		flex-direction: row;
	}
	.donate-form {
		margin-bottom: 52px;
	}
	.page-about__section-quote {
		margin: 0 45px;
	}
	.page-about__section-quote br {
		content: '';
	}

}

@media (max-width: 575px) {

	.container {
		padding-left: 15px;
		padding-right: 15px;
	}

	.hidden-xs {
		display: none;
	}

	/* Header */
	.mobile-nav__close {
		right: 30px;
		left: auto;
	}

	/* Section */
	.section-header__title {
		font-size: 30px;
		line-height: 41px;
	}

	/* Hero */
	.hero {
		padding-top: 82px;
	}
	.hero__content {
		padding-top: 182px;
		padding-bottom: 112px;
	}
	.hero__h1 {
		margin-bottom: 30px;
		font-size: 20px;
		line-height: 28px;
	}
	.hero__h1 span {
		font-size: 46px;
		line-height: 62px;
	}
	.hero__action {
		-webkit-box-orient: vertical;
		-webkit-box-direction: normal;
		-webkit-flex-direction: column;
		-moz-box-orient: vertical;
		-moz-box-direction: normal;
		-ms-flex-direction: column;
		flex-direction: column;
		-webkit-box-align: start;
		-webkit-align-items: flex-start;
		-moz-box-align: start;
		-ms-flex-align: start;
		align-items: flex-start; 
	}
	.hero__action .btn {
		margin-bottom: 20px;
	}
	.hero__collage {
		width: 620px !important;
		right: -260px;
	}
	.server-list {
		padding-left: 5px;
		padding-right: 5px;
		bottom: -202px;
	}
	.server-item {
		margin-left: 10px;
		margin-right: 10px;
	}

	/* How to start */
	.how-to-start {
		padding-top: 200px;
	}
	.how-to-start__header {
	    margin-bottom: 30px;
	}
	.how-to-start__header .section-header__title {
		margin-bottom: 15px;
	}
	.how-to-start .section-header__desc {
		margin-bottom: 30px;
	}
	.instruction {
	    padding: 30px 0 0;
	}

	/* News */
	.news {
	    padding: 30px 0;
	}
	.news .section-header__title {
		margin-bottom: 15px;
	}
	.news-carousel .news-item__wrapper {
		padding: 0 10px;
	}
	.news-item__title {
	    font-size: 18px;
	    line-height: 24px;
	}
	.news-carousel .slick-track {
		padding-top: 20px;
		padding-bottom: 60px;
	}
	.news-carousel .slick-center {
	    -webkit-transform: scale(1);
	    -moz-transform: scale(1);
	    -ms-transform: scale(1);
	    -o-transform: scale(1);
	    transform: scale(1);
	}

	/* Social */
	.social {
	    padding: 30px 0 0;
	}
	.social-item__title {
	    font-size: 18px;
	    line-height: 24px;
	}

	/* Footer */
	.footer {
		padding: 30px 0 15px;
	}
	.footer .col-12 {
		margin-bottom: 15px;
	}
	.footer__logo {
	    margin-bottom: 15px;
	}
	.copyright__small {
	    margin-bottom: 15px;
	}

	/* Popup */
	.popup {
	    padding: 15px;
	}
	.fancybox-button {
	    top: 0px !important;
	    right: 0 !important;
	}

	/* Content */
	.content {
		margin-bottom: 30px;
	}
	.page-transfers {
		padding-bottom: 30px;
	}
	.table-wrapper table,
	.table-wrapper tbody,
	.table-wrapper tr,
	.table-wrapper td {
		display: block;
	}
	.table-wrapper tr {
		padding: 10px 0;
	}
	.table-wrapper td {
		padding: 5px 0;
		text-align: left;
	}
	.donate-wrapper {
	    margin-bottom: 30px;
	}
	.donate-form {
		margin-bottom: 30px;
		padding: 30px 15px;
		min-height: 0;
	}
	.bonus__inner {
	    padding: 30px 15px;
	}
	.bonus__prize {
	    padding-top: 30px;
	    font-size: 66px;
	}
	.bonus__prize span {
	    font-size: 26px;
	}
	.bonus__price {
	    font-size: 30px;
	    line-height: 42px;
	}
	.bonus__price-old {
	    font-size: 20px;
	    line-height: 28px;
	}
	.page-about__section {
		margin-bottom: 30px;
	}
	.page-about__section h2 {
	    font-size: 32px;
	    line-height: 44px;
	}
	.page-about__section_type_highlighted {
	    padding-top: 30px;
	    padding-bottom: 30px;
	}
	.page-about__section-1 h2 {
		margin-bottom: 30px;
	}
	.page-about__section-video > iframe {
		height: 300px !important;
	}
	.page-about__section-quote {
		margin-bottom: 15px;
	}
	.page-roulette__nav > div:first-child {
		margin-bottom: 15px;
	}

	.page-roulette__balance,
	.page-roulette__nav,
	.roulette-carousel__start-holder,
	.page-roulette__h2 {
		margin-bottom: 48px;
	}
	.roulette-carousel__start-holder {
		margin-bottom: 68px;
	}
	.roulette-carousel {
		margin-bottom: 24px;
	}
	.roulette-prize-list__categories {
		margin-bottom: -30px;
	}
	.roulette-prize-list__categories .roulette-prize__wrapper {
		margin-bottom: 48px;
	}
	.roulette-winner__prize-holder {
	    padding: 0;
	}
	.about-roulette {
		padding-top: 90px;
	}
	.about-roulette__title {
		font-size: 32px;
		line-height: 44px;
	}
	.about-roulette .row .col-12 {
		padding-bottom: 30px;
	}
	.about-roulette__close {
		top: 30px;
		right: 15px;
	}

}